<p>The commenting software, <a href="http://www.intensedebate.com">Intense Debate</a>, was acquired by <a href="http://automattic.com/">Automattic</a> today according <a href="http://www.intensedebate.com/blog/2008/09/23/automattic-acquires-intensedebate/">an announcement on their blog</a>.  I&#8217;ve <a href="http://www.bwana.org/2008/06/12/intense-debate-is-the-easy-choice/">went on record</a> to state my support for Intense Debate and their benefits over their main competitor, <a href="http://www.disqus.com">Disqus</a>.  Recently, I&#8217;ve been beta testing some of their newer features and I can definitely see the reasoning behind the acquisition.  There are some exciting features coming!</p>
<p>Intense Debate has temporarily went back into private beta (which won&#8217;t affect current users), so you&#8217;ll need to wait a bit to create a new account.  If you&#8217;re not familiar with Automattic, they are the parent company of great blogging software such as WordPress, Akismet, and Gravatar.  Intense Debate adds a great commenting system to the fold and I can&#8217;t wait to see what becomes of the merged technologies.  </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div align="right" style="float: right; padding: 10px 0px 5px 5px;"><a name="fb_share" type="button_count" share_url="http://www.bwana.org/2008/06/12/intense-debate-is-the-easy-choice/"></a></div><p><a href="http://www.intensedebate.com"><img src="http://img.skitch.com/20080507-fqi9wcb8t4ms8eymhkpbum3cqy.preview.jpg" border="0" hspace="5"  vspace="5" align="left" style="padding: 5px;"/></a> A while ago, <a href="http://www.bwana.org/2008/05/14/intense-debate-or-disqus-im-torn/">I wrote about</a> my difficult decision between choosing from the commenting systems, <a href="http://www.disqus.com">Disqus</a> and <a href="http://www.intensedebate.com">Intense Debate</a>. Much has changed since that post, including <a href="http://blog.disqus.net/2008/05/14/disqus-now-with-100-more-video/">Disqus&#8217;s support of video comments</a> and now, <a href="http://www.intensedebate.com/blog/2008/06/11/intensedebate-friendfeed/">Intense Debate&#8217;s support of FriendFeed</a>.  <strong>At this moment, the only benefit I see of using Disqus over Intense Debate is its support of video comments</strong>.  This makes the decision a lot easier for me.  Now that Intense Debate supports <a href="http://www.friendfeed.com">FriendFeed</a>, it becomes a no-brainer:</p>
<p><strong>The ability to import and export existing comments with ease propels Intense Debate as the clear winner.</strong></p>
<div class="thumbnail"><a href="http://friendfeed.com/e/5cff40a5-e47d-9903-ed21-7196fa879841/Intense-Debate-New-IntenseDebate-Features-Reply/"><img src="http://img.skitch.com/20080612-rg1u3n99n78dpungpthjkbx9cm.preview.jpg" alt="Intense Debate : New IntenseDebate Features: Reply By Email, FreindFeed, Me.dium, &#038; Orkut Integration - FriendFeed" /></a><br /><br/></div>
<p>Both Disqus and Intense Debate now support FriendFeed, both have great moderation options, both have a decent reputation system.  The huge difference here is that my existing data is safe AND my future data is easily accessible.  I realize Disqus has data portability options available, but Intense Debate&#8217;s are much simpler in my mind.  I also realize, with Disqus, you can keep your existing comments on your blog and only use Disqus for new posts.  (Intense Debate has the same option)  While this workaround may be sufficient for some, I&#8217;m not a big fan of keeping two separate commenting systems on the same blog.  Intense Debate&#8217;s solution is more elegant, seamless, and easier for the user to use and maintain.  </p>
